数据库id是什么意思

不及物动词 其他 25

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库id是指数据库中记录的唯一标识符。在数据库中,每个记录都有一个唯一的标识符,用于区分不同的数据项。这个标识符通常是一个整数或字符串,称为id(也可以是其他名称,如主键、唯一标识等)。

    数据库id的作用是用于标识和定位数据库中的数据。通过id,可以快速找到并操作特定的记录。数据库id通常是自动生成的,可以保证其唯一性。在创建记录时,数据库会自动为每条记录分配一个唯一的id。

    通过数据库id,我们可以进行各种操作,如插入、更新、删除和查询等。在插入新记录时,数据库会自动为其生成一个唯一的id。在更新或删除记录时,可以使用id来定位目标记录。在查询数据时,可以通过id来快速检索和获取特定的记录。

    总之,数据库id是用于唯一标识和定位数据库中记录的标识符,通过id可以实现对数据库中数据的各种操作。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库id是指数据库中每个记录的唯一标识符。在关系型数据库中,每个表都有一个主键,主键用于唯一标识表中的每个记录。主键可以是一个或多个列的组合,但是每个主键值都必须是唯一的。

    数据库id的作用是确保每个记录都有一个唯一的标识符,以便于在数据库中进行数据的增删改查操作。通过使用id,可以方便地对数据库中的记录进行索引和查找,提高数据库的查询效率。

    以下是关于数据库id的几个重要的概念和作用:

    1. 唯一标识符:数据库id是用来唯一标识数据库中的每个记录的。每个记录都有一个唯一的id值,通过id可以准确定位到某个记录。

    2. 主键:数据库id通常作为表的主键,主键用于唯一标识表中的每个记录。主键的值在整个表中必须是唯一的,且不能为空。

    3. 索引:数据库id常常用作索引的列。通过对id列创建索引,可以提高对数据库的查询效率。索引可以加快数据的查找速度,减少数据库的IO开销。

    4. 外键关联:数据库id可以用作外键关联的列。外键是表与表之间的关联,通过外键可以建立表与表之间的关系。通过使用id作为外键,可以方便地在不同的表之间进行关联查询。

    5. 数据库优化:数据库id的设计和使用也是数据库性能优化的一个重要方面。合理地设计和使用id可以提高数据库的性能和查询效率。例如,可以使用自增长的id值,避免频繁的插入和删除操作导致id的碎片化。同时,也可以考虑使用分布式id生成算法,以减少数据库的压力。

    总之,数据库id是用来唯一标识数据库中每个记录的标识符,它在数据库的设计和使用中具有重要的作用。通过合理地设计和使用id,可以提高数据库的性能和查询效率。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库id是指数据库中每个记录的唯一标识符。在数据库中,每个记录都有一个独特的id,用于区分和识别不同的记录。这个id通常是一个整数值,它可以是自动生成的,也可以是手动指定的。

    数据库id的作用是确保每个记录都有一个唯一的标识符,以便于在数据库中进行定位和操作。通过id,我们可以快速地找到特定的记录,并对其进行修改、删除或查询。

    数据库id的生成方式可以有多种,常见的有自增长id和GUID。

    自增长id是指在插入新记录时,数据库会自动分配一个新的id值,比上一条记录的id值大1。这种方式简单、高效,但不够安全,因为用户可以通过猜测id值来访问其他记录。

    GUID(全局唯一标识符)是一种由算法生成的唯一标识符,它的长度通常为128位。GUID保证了每个id的全局唯一性,几乎可以认为是不重复的。GUID适用于需要保证数据的全局唯一性的场景,但由于其长度较长,会占用更多的存储空间。

    在数据库设计中,我们通常会为每个表添加一个自增长的id列作为主键,以确保每个记录的唯一性。这样可以方便地进行数据操作和查询,并且可以通过id快速定位到特定的记录。同时,还可以通过id实现表之间的关联和连接。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部